Finding The Right Mobility Scooter For Your Needs


Being unable to walk long distances can be devastating to your freedom. You may miss out on many family activities and fun events simply because you don't have the ability to stand on your own for long periods of time. Luckily, mobility scooters are available to allow you to get outside, move around your home with ease, or even travel.

When looking for a mobility scooter of your own, make sure you pick the right one for your needs. This guide helps you pick the best one:

What do you want your mobility scooter for?

If you don't need a mobility scooter while you are home but want one for when you are outdoors in your garden or enjoying family events, you may want to consider an outdoor version. With tighter turning capabilities and thicker tire tread, outdoor mobility scooters allow you to travel on sidewalks, sand, and grass with ease.

What car do you have?

If you need a mobility scooter to take with you when you run errands, make sure you choose a brand and style that will fit in your vehicle. Some models are very large, and can only ride on the back of a vehicle, while others are compact enough to fit right inside. If this is a concern, you may want to buy a van or other roomy vehicle to place your mobility scooter in when you leave the house.

How often will you use your scooter?

If a mobility scooter is something you will need to use most of the time, you want to make sure you choose a model that turns and backs up easily, doesn't take up a lot of space, and holds a battery charge for long periods of time. Some companies allow you to rent mobility scooters so you can try out different models until you find one you like. Do this before making a purchase so you know your mobility scooter can handle turns and entryways in your home.
